6 snared at Noblesville sobriety checkpoint
A Noblesville sobriety checkpoint resulted in six arrests late last night. More than 20 officers from several Hamilton County Departments pulled over 150 westbound vehicles near the Emmanuel United Methodist Church in the 9800 block of Greenfield Avenue.

New owner of Sheridan Airport plans to court private pilots
The new owner of a rural Hamilton County airport says he intends to cater to recreational fliers being squeezed out of other airports by corporate jets.
Storms spawn tornado warnings across region
Weather spotters have indicated a funnel cloud near Thorntown in Boone County. Radio scanner traffic indicated trained weather spotters were tracking a funnel cloud on the ground between Thorntown and Sheridan around 8 p.m. Saturday.

One dead in Hamilton County crash
One person died and another was injured in a crash at 186th and Casey Road. The accident site was northwest of Westfield, north of State Road 32 between Spring Mill and Eagletown Roads.
